Students will conduct an individual research project under the close supervision of one or more academic staff. Projects will, at least in part, require the application of theoretical or experimental research techniques. In particular, students will be expected to conduct and present a survey of the literature relevant to the research topic.

Students will prepare a thesis reporting on the research project and its outcomes. They will also be expected to present a poster and a short seminar describing their work.

Students will be expected to apply their software engineering knowledge and skills in the planning and execution of their research project. 

Learning Outcomes

Upon successful completion, students will have the knowledge and skills to:

  1. Prepare and present a short technical seminar
  2. Write a literature survey
  3. Undertake and complete a research project under supervision
  4. Prepare and present a technical poster
  5. Write a thesis describing the results of research work
